The real trick is to decide which criteria are the most important comparison points for your personal situation. Some of the criteria you need to consider are as follows: Loan Availability Is this a no proof of income loan that you can get? All UK lenders have specific criteria for deciding on whether or not to lend their money to an applicant. If your credit is poor, then it does not make any sense to apply for a loan meant for people with an excellent credit history. Plus, applications which are repeatedly turned down will show up on your credit history. Loan Amount In some cases, the amount of the loan you need will help you rule out certain lenders. You obviously won't apply to a lender who only will approve loans up to £10,000 if you know that you need twice that. However, many lenders will not tell you the amount that they will approve until you request a quote from them. Once you have that, once again, you can eliminate those that cannot meet your needs. APR The annual percentage rate is the rate of interest you will pay on a no proof of income loan expressed as an annual figure. While many finance experts will tell you this is the most important comparison point, it's only one comparison point. A loan with a low APR and a short repayment term may still be unaffordable because your monthly payment is beyond your budget means. Your Credit Rating Your credit rating, is increasingly important, will definitely affect the type of no proof of income loan for which you apply, as well as the amount the lender will be willing to lend and the interest rate that they will offer. Before applying for an online loan or otherwise, take your time to check your own credit report, now easily available online, and make any necessary corrections you need to get your credit rating as good as possible.
